A one-person monthly baseline (1BR rent plus typical utilities) runs $930 in Green Bay, WI versus $890 in Laramie, WY. Overall, Laramie, WY is roughly 4% cheaper to live in day-to-day than Green Bay, WI, driven mainly by electricity costs.

Median household income is $62,546 in Green Bay, WI and $52,414 in Laramie, WY — about 16% higher in Green Bay, WI. Wisconsin has a top state income tax rate of 7.65% and a 5% state sales tax; Wyoming has no state income tax and a 4% state sales tax.

Green Bay vs Laramie — FAQ

Is it cheaper to live in Green Bay or Laramie?
Laramie, WY is cheaper. Its monthly baseline of $890 (1BR rent + utilities) runs about 4% below Green Bay, WI's $930, mainly because of electricity costs.
How much more do you need to earn to live in Green Bay than in Laramie?
To keep rent near the recommended 30% of gross income, you'd want to earn roughly $29,000 a year in Green Bay versus $29,000 in Laramie.
Which has lower taxes, Green Bay or Laramie?
Green Bay is taxed under Wisconsin's rules (a top state income tax rate of 7.65% and a 5% state sales tax); Laramie under Wyoming's (no state income tax and a 4% state sales tax).
